New CMP Pistol Marksmanship 101 Class and M9 EIC Match Debut at Talladega Spring Classic

Talladega, AL – The Civilian Marksmanship Program introduced its first Pistol Marksmanship 101 class and accompanying M9 EIC pistol match on Wednesday, 17 March at the CMP Talladega Marksmanship Park ahead of rain and thunder later in the day.

At the match, Michael Cameron, 65, of Baton Rouge, LA, earned his four introductory Excellence-In-Competition pistol points toward 30 required to earn a Distinguished Pistol Shot badge. With a score of 244-1X, Cameron was tops among the points-eligible shooters. He was followed by LTJG Brandon Critchfield, USCG (219) and CPT Jennifer Creasy, USAR (209).

Arthur Rubin, 61, of Lincolnwood, IL, led all 16 competitors in the three-stage match with a score of 249-1X. Rubin earned his introductory EIC pistol points in 2013. Bald Eagles Multiply by 4 Times!

Bald Eagles have multiplied by 4 times in population size across the Lower 48 States during the past 10 years (photo by Paul Konrad).

During the past 10 years, Bald Eagles have multiplied by 4 times in population size across the Lower 48 States, with a total estimate at 316,708 Bald Eagles. That’s especially exciting news considering that most Bald Eagles nest in Canada and Alaska, and it shows the continued success of Bald Eagle nesting since our national bird was listed as an endangered species. Bald Eagles were removed from the endangered list in 2007, and populations continue to increase in numbers at surprising rates.

For the past 50 years, the US Fish and Wildlife Service has been estimating the number of Bald Eagle nests, using counts provided by each state and adding aerial survey data to track the population recovery of America’s national symbol. But in its new Bald Eagle population report, tabulated with the help of results using eBird data from the Cornell Lab of Ornithology, the USFWS found many more eagles and eagle nests than previously thought to exist in the Lower 48 states.

Bald Eagle numbers were broken down by flyway with the Mississippi Flyway supporting the most eagles at 159,772; with 84,541 in the Atlantic Flyway; 42,068 in the Pacific Flyway; and 30,427 in the Central Flyway. The numbers of active nests have more than doubled since 2007 to include 71,467 nesting pairs in 2020.

The much improved nesting success and population increases for Bald Eagles is primarily the result of banning DDT and similar pesticides in 1972 throughout the United States. These pesticides caused severe eggshell thinning that led to broken eggs and failed nesting attempts year after year among Bald Eagles, Ospreys, Peregrine Falcons, Brown Pelicans, and other large predatory birds that are at the top of affected food chains. Dickinson Royal Series Over & Under

Premium Sidelock Shotgun Available in 12- and 20-Gauge Models

The Royal Series Over & Under from Dickinson Arms proves that shooters can get a premium, collector-quality shotgun without breaking the bank or waiting forever to get a custom gun made.

The Royal Series offers everything serious shooters look for in a premium over & under, beginning with premium grade Turkish walnut and a hand removable side lock design with an intercepting safety sear and additional pin anchoring that make this gun superior to typical five-pin models.

The CNC-machined receiver is milled from a solid block of molybdenum chrome steel and finished with true Bone Charcoal Case Hardening that makes each gun an individual work of art. The receiver is accented with beautiful hand engraved English scroll work. The finish, 24-lines-per-inch checkering of the premium Turkish walnut stock, and final fitting are all hand done by skilled craftsmen.

The Royal Series doesn’t just look great on display; it is ruggedly built for reliable long-term performance. Its premium construction features include a gated barrel selector, automatic ejectors, heavy-duty hammer springs and precision CNC-machined internal components. It is available in both 12-gauge and 20-gauge versions, and a range of barrel lengths including 24”, 26”, 28” and 30” to cover a wide range of shooting styles.
